Users that use ESPN Plus on Firestick devices follow these steps to turn off subtitles: Play any video on your Firestick device and press the Menu button on your Firestick remote and then click Setting > Accessibility > Closed Captions and then turn off the Closed Captions option. In general, standard-sized walk-in tubs require at least a 50-gallon water heater, while larger-sized tubs (such as models for patients with obesity or couples) will need a 75-gallon water heater.
